US Labor Market Shows Signs of Improvement Despite Revised Job Growth Numbers

The US labor market showed signs of improvement in January,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ics. The nonfarm payrolls increased by 130,000, surpassing the Dow Jones consensus estimate of 55,000. This marks a significant increase from December's gain of 48,000.

The unemployment rate also edged lower to 4.3%, below the forecast of staying unchanged at 4.4% from the prior month. The report comes as a relief to concerns about the state of the US labor market.

However, the Bureau of Labor Statistics released a benchmark update in February, which revised down the nonfarm employment level for March 2025 by 898,000. This revision significantly impacted the jobs story, with total job growth being revised from +584,000 to +181,000.
